Fables and myths are the first genre that hooked me. Over the years, I've tried reading romance books but I've gotten quickly bored of the constant cliches. Then my interest shifted to sci-fi/fantasy. It had been a long time before I've tried reading historical fiction books, then some non-fiction books that are somewhat related to the two genres, or if it really piques my interest. There are times that I reading books of different genres, however, I still read either historical fiction or sci-fi/fantasy most of the time.
